Exteriors
Most of these exteriors were painted on site, and some of them took many return visits painting for several hours to complete, surrounded by yellow jackets, snakes and squirrels. A lot of sunscreen went into the creation of these paintings.

Standing alone in the junkyard with an igloo of Gatorade, singing along to Tom Waits and Beck on my Sony Discman, the sun slowly creeping across the cars and the weeds growing even more slowly between them, my sense of time was profoundly altered while I painted these works.

One might get the impression from these paintings that I like old cars.
